I enjoyed eating lunch here. The food tasted great, the portion was just right and the service was top notch. But what I enjoyed the most about this place, was to see and hear happy employees. Most of the employees at this place are from Mexico, which bodes well for the food, but that combined with a good vibe among them makes for a nice atmosphere. Nobody likes to eat at a place where the employees are unhappy; even if the food is great. I enjoyed hearing the employees exchange stories in the back and laugh as they joked with each other. My waitress was very attentive and friendly. She stopped to chat with me about Mexico and all the places she’s lived in the US. And as you can see from the pic, I also very much enjoyed the food. Is it a 5-star restaurant in the sense that the food is gourmet or fancy bistro-style? No, but it serves great tasting Mexican food along with excellent service in a great atmosphere. So to me that deserves 5 stars.

This was my first time coming here yesterday. The staff are friendly and you get serviced right away. However, I ordered the carne asada plate which is around $16-$17. It seems like a alot of food when they first bring you the plate. But I came to the conclusion that all they do is put alot of refried beans and scatter the Mexican rice. And then add of small steak with lots of pico de Gallo and guacamole. All I ate was the meat and rice. The beans didn't taste good and the guacamole was too salty. This dish also comes with 4 flour tortillas. I was disappointed because their tortillas are store bought. I had high standards last night because of the pricing.
